Race 1 - Non-Winners 1 Race

2 - GALVESTON tired late after firing to the fore from post 8 last week. He's exhibited better staying power in previous outings, and now he gains the cosiest draw he's had all season. 6 - ROCK ON LOU sustained wide gains up the far side into the fastest quarter of the race two weeks ago, and still had enough left in the tank to take third. Credit his pressing effort - albeit futile - the start before, too. 1 - ISSA HORSE returns to action after 7-1/2 months off, and his two local qualifiers indicate solid staying ability. Last week, he was a good third behind the classy Captain Ahab. Can contend; mind value.

Race 2 - John Simpson Memorial (2yo colts and geldings)

2 - JACK FIRE chased for minors in a pair of Grand Circuit events at Lexington. That success on that stage gives the four-time winner a massive class edge in this group. Far and away the one to beat. 3 - LEPANTO seeks a fourth straight win after tearing through the Stallion Series and narrowly holding in the Liberty Bell two weeks ago. Likely pacesetter is going to have to pick things up a good bit today; mind value. 1 - PILOT HANOVER pressed and just missed Lepanto in their meeting two weeks ago, but showed promise in his uncovered gains for over four furlongs. Pole can help him stay fresh.

Race 3 - John Simpson Memorial (2yo colts and geldings)

6 - HIS BEATS HANOVER lifted into a pair of near misses in his last two tries, including in the Liberty Bell two weeks ago. While still a maiden, he's finally finding his best strides and some fast miles. 3 - CYRUS PEAK hit the exacta in five straight outings, via pacesetting, pocket and pressing bids alike. Versatility and form both encourage. 2 - NOT TODAY showed success in both the Excelsior and Freehold stakes series this summer, and he's well drawn to be involved with the pace from the outset. That said, raw speed will have to improve in order to contend for more than a minor.

Race 4 - John Simpson Memorial (2yo colts and geldings)

6 - SUNNY CROCKETT won his Liberty Bell split decisively two weeks ago after a no-match second in the Standardbred at Delaware. He's only missed the board once in his career; form and class tower over the others. 1 - FLEMSTEEN pressed a :28 4/5 third quarter up the far side in his last, and held third after flattening. He's hit the board in all but one start to date, and that fourth-place finish was a narrow miss off cover in the Keystone Classic. 4 - INCENTIVE has improved markedly in recent outings. While outmatched in the Haughton, he's fared OK locally and showed improved chasing ability in pursuit of Sunny Crockett in their last meeting.

Race 5 - Non-Winners $4,350 Last 5 Starts

6 - VALLEY OF SIN made an uncharacteristic break at Pocono in his last after a game second-place finish the week before. Now, the 10-year-old drops two levels below that runner-up effort. Well equipped to rebound. 2 - WINNING PRINCESS rises after delivering a dominant bottom-level score at Pocono in her last. The ease with which she drew off from Casa Palmera encourages greatly. 1 - OVERNIGHT SHIPPER gets a pass from his last two, owing to his sustained uncovered pushes through the middle half on both occasions. Pole can yield an easier journey for this value player. 4 - SPEED IT and 8 - NOBLE WARRAWEE were runners-up in their respective most recent starts, and can rise for minor shares in this event.

Race 6 - John Simpson Memorial (2yo colts and geldings)

5 - SOMEWHEREINVERONA almost lasted on the point in the Liberty Bell - but had to leave from the eight-hole to clear and hadn't raced in nearly a month before that. Expect sharper second out. 3 - MYSWEETBOYMAX rode the pocket to upend Somewhereinverona, but didn't have to exert himself at all to achieve that position. He did demonstrate some pressing ability in the PA Sire Stakes consolation, but I'd be wary of accepting a short price on him. 2 - BET MINE closed steadily from the pack to only miss the aforementioned pair by two lengths. With the short field and cosy draw, he won't have to make up nearly as much ground this time.

Race 7 - John Simpson Memorial (2yo colts and geldings)

4 - BILLY CLYDE drops in from a pair of even but non-threatening Grand Circuit outings at Lexington. He was a steadily-closing third over this course in an early-season PASS event. Class edge can carry; MacDonald opts on. 3 - WHICHWAYTOTHEBEACH just missed out of the pocket last out in his first start back since a hard-earned third in the Keystone Classic. He hasn't missed the board to date; versatility is apparent. 5 - ALWAYS B SWEET lifted late to just miss Mysweetboymax by a length after working for early position in their Liberty Bell split. Prior to that, he charged home in :25 4/5 to take second in a Kindergarten split. Solid stayer, to say the absolute least.

Race 8 - Non-Winners 3 Races or $30,000

6 - BUY IN was outmatched in his Liberty Bell division and was tasked with giving futile chase from astern to stakes-tested colts like Tru Lou, Allywag Hanover and Manticore. The big takeaway: His 1:50 1/5 mile is the fastest over three turns on this page. Far easier await today. 7 - TERRITORY hit the board in his last six and nearly rated his way to victory in the slop at this level last week. Wide draw is his main obstacle; form encourages. 8 - SEA OF LIFE broke the 1:50 mark twice at Lexington in Kentucky Sire Stakes competition — including in the Sept. 20 final in pursuit of Tall Dark Stranger. Pressing and stalking ability against the best of the best both noted.

Race 9 - Non-Winners 1 Race

6 - TRAIN was second in his last two outings, both from close tracking trips. Nap takes over the lines on this improving son of Cantab Hall. 1 - BOOM CITY chased respectably to hit the board in three of his last five, and this inside draw can help him stay sharp once again. 4 - INTEGER chased evenly in his last, but was demoted on account of the interference he caused by pushing in at the start. Improved staying power can help him boost exotic value.

Race 10 - Non-Winners $7,000 Last 5 Starts

6 - STARVIN MARVIN earned minors in four of his last five tries, all against significantly tougher. Raw speed and staying power are both ample for this group, into which he is the lone class dropper. 5 - CLOUSEAU HANOVER pressed well for second in a similar race at Pocono last out, and did the same three back. Ability to take air is a big plus. 2 - RAZOR'S EDGE rises after wiring second-level foes in 1:51 on Sunday. He had a fair bit of pace in reserve at the winning post on that occasion, which is encouraging on this bump up.

Race 11 - Non-Winners $2,500 Last 5 Starts

8 - BOMBAY HANOVER simply failed to get involved in his last couple starts, but showed ability at this level and one above last month. This group shapes up as fairly manageable, despite the wide draw. 4 - DRUNK ON YOUR LOVE pushed clear at the bell last week before yielding and gapping the box on the far turn. Give due credit for his early exertion. 3 - POGEY BEACH pressed steadily up the far side in the same race Drunk On Your Love exits, and that was after working to seal off the pocket early. Any trip relief can help him improve.

Race 12 - Non-Winners 3 Races or $30,000

1 - TEST MY NAUGHTY B looks for a hat trick after winning her last two at this level. She's well drawn to control the terms from the outset, but she does show ability to sustain uncovered progress as well. Lots to like. 2 - ANDELA lifted steadily to win at this level four back, and since chased into the board in her last two. Fairly consistent stayer should be able to stay close with ease once again. 6 - HIGHWAY TO THE SKY rebounded from a pair of breaks well with an even fourth-place effort over off going last time. She's an OK stayer, and as such figures to boost exotic value with a similar effort.

Race 13 - F&M Non-Winners 1 Race

5 - CAVIART LUCIA makes her debut off a stretch of improving qualifiers, both at M1 and Lexington. Late pace - albeit mostly on the straightaway - towers over these foes. 1 - MISS TANGO hit the board in six of her last seven, including recent pocket and pressing efforts. Pole keeps her close to the action once again; beware underlay potential. 3 - BEAVER CREEK MISTY had to work for the pocket in her last few starts, and she almost converted at over 100-1 in her last! Forgive two back owing to traffic. Solid value option.

Race 14 - Non-Winners $4,000 Last 5 Starts

5 - EFFRONTE A was better than even two back and improve mightily in his last: a first-over grind into a quickening pace to just miss Tact Tate N. He steps down from that gritty effort and draws favourably. 1 - CAPTAIN DISOMMA suffered from severe traffic trouble in his last, but kept even with a pretty strong pace. Pole can keep him close; clear sailing is a must. 7 - DRAGON STRIKES drops in class after even efforts for minors in his last three at Pocono. Value option in deeper exotics with similar staying power.
